Wheatland Electric Cooperative Inc is a 501(c)(12) organization based in Scott City, Kansas, registered in 1953, with $105,441,948 in FY2024 revenue. CharityIndex grades it A, and it directs about 100% of spending to programs.

To provide quality and reliable electric service to members at cost on a cooperative basis.
Providing water distribution contracts to customers in finney and kearny counties. services are provided on a cooperative basis.
Revenue declined from $141.5M (FY2013) to $105.4M (FY2024) across 12 reported years.
